LOSS OF USE, D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ER 00031 * CAUSED AND ON ANY TH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, 00032 * OR TORT (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E 00033 * O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. 00034 * 00035 ****************************************************************************** 00036 */ 00037 00038 /* Define to prevent recursive inclusion -------------------------------------*/ 00039 #ifndef __STM32L4xx_HAL_CRC_EX_H 00040 #define __STM32L4xx_HAL_CRC_EX_H 00041 00042 #ifdef __cplusplus 00043 extern "C" { 00044 #endif 00045 00046 /* Includes ------------------------------------------------------------------*/ 00047 #include "stm32l4xx_hal_def.h" 00048 00049 /** @addtogroup STM32L4xx_HAL_Driver 00050 * @{ 00051 */ 00052 00053 /** @addtogroup CRCEx 00054 * @{ 00055 */ 00056 00057 /* Exported types ------------------------------------------------------------*/ 00058 /* Exported constants --------------------------------------------------------*/ 00059 /** @defgroup CRCEx_Exported_Constants CRCEx Exported Constants 00060 * @{ 00061 */ 00062 00063 /** @defgroup CRCEx_Input_Data_Inversion Input Data Inversion Modes 00064 * @{ 00065 */ 00066 #define CRC_INPUTDATA_INVERSION_NONE ((uint32_t)0x00000000) /*!< No input data inversion */ 00067 #define CRC_INPUTDATA_INVERSION_BYTE ((uint32_t)CRC_CR_REV_IN_0) /*!< Byte-wise input data inversion */ 00068 #define CRC_INPUTDATA_INVERSION_HALFWORD ((uint32_t)CRC_CR_REV_IN_1) /*!< HalfWord-wise input data inversion */ 00069 #define CRC_INPUTDATA_INVERSION_WORD ((uint32_t)CRC_CR_REV_IN) /*!< Word-wise input data inversion */ 00070 /** 00071 * @} 00072 */ 00073 00074 /** @defgroup CRCEx_Output_Data_Inversion Output Data Inversion Modes 00075 * @{ 00076 */ 00077 #define CRC_OUTPUTDATA_INVERSION_DISABLE ((uint32_t)0x00000000) /*!< No output data inversion */ 00078 #define CRC_OUTPUTDATA_INVERSION_ENABLE ((uint32_t)CRC_CR_REV_OUT) /*!< Bit-wise output data inversion */ 00079 /** 00080 * @} 00081 */ 00082 00083 /** 00084 * @} 00085 */ 00086 00087 /* Exported macro ------------------------------------------------------------*/ 00088 /** @defgroup CRCEx_Exported_Macros CRCEx Exported Macros 00089 * @{ 00090 */ 00091 00092 /** 00093 * @brief Set CRC output reversal 00094 * @param __HANDLE__: CRC handle 00095 * @retval None 00096 */ 00097 #define __HAL_CRC_OUTPUTREVERSAL_ENABLE(__HANDLE__) ((__HANDLE__)->Instance->CR |= CRC_CR_REV_OUT) 00098 00099 /** 00100 * @brief Unset CRC output reversal 00101 * @param __HANDLE__: CRC handle 00102 * @retval None 00103 */ 00104 #define __HAL_CRC_OUTPUTREVERSAL_DISABLE(__HANDLE__) ((__HANDLE__)->Instance->CR &= ~(CRC_CR_REV_OUT)) 00105 00106 /** 00107 * @brief Set CRC non-default polynomial 00108 * @param __HANDLE__: CRC handle 00109 * @param __POLYNOMIAL__: 7, 8, 16 or 32-bit polynomial 00110 * @retval None 00111 */ 00112 #define __HAL_CRC_POLYNOMIAL_CONFIG(__HANDLE__, __POLYNOMIAL__) ((__HANDLE__)->Instance->POL = (__POLYNOMIAL__)) 00113 00114 /** 00115 * @} 00116 */ 00117 00118 /* Private macros --------------------------------------------------------*/ 00119 /** @addtogroup CRCEx_Private_Macros CRCEx Private Macros 00120 * @{ 00121 */ 00122 00123 #define IS_CRC_INPUTDATA_INVERSION_MODE(MODE) (((MODE) == CRC_INPUTDATA_INVERSION_NONE) || \ 00124 ((MODE) == CRC_INPUTDATA_INVERSION_BYTE) || \ 00125 ((MODE) == CRC_INPUTDATA_INVERSION_HALFWORD) || \ 00126 ((MODE) == CRC_INPUTDATA_INVERSION_WORD)) 00127 00128 00129 #define IS_CRC_OUTPUTDATA_INVERSION_MODE(MODE) (((MODE) == CRC_OUTPUTDATA_INVERSION_DISABLE) || \ 00130 ((MODE) == CRC_OUTPUTDATA_INVERSION_ENABLE)) 00131 00132 /** 00133 * @} 00134 */ 00135 00136 /* Exported functions --------------------------------------------------------*/ 00137 00138 /** @addtogroup CRCEx_Exported_Functions CRC Extended Exported Functions 00139 * @{ 00140 */ 00141 00142 /** @addtogroup CRCEx_Exported_Functions_Group1 Extended Initialization/de-initialization functions 00143 * @{ 00144 */ 00145 00146 /* Initialization and de-initialization functions ****************************/ 00147 HAL_StatusTypeDef HAL_CRCEx_Polynomial_Set(CRC_HandleTypeDef *hcrc, uint32_t Pol, uint32_t PolyLength); 00148 HAL_StatusTypeDef HAL_CRCEx_Input_Data_Reverse(CRC_HandleTypeDef *hcrc, uint32_t InputReverseMode); 00149 HAL_StatusTypeDef HAL_CRCEx_Output_Data_Reverse(CRC_HandleTypeDef *hcrc, uint32_t OutputReverseMode);
